Since No Mercy hes had bumps in regarding to his albums, never had his full potential to actually shine through.
No Mercy = Originally was supposed to be King Uncaged, scrapped, had a very months in 2010 to do something.
Trouble Man = Despite being actually a great album, no idea what youre talking about, from what ive been told is that He really was glad that the album got finally put out and was done with it.
Paperwork = Garbage overall. No direction of the sound. Great songs but that is what happens when conflict between Pharrell & DJ Toomp happens.
Dime Trap = Originally a 22 or 25 track album. Cut down by Epic Records. Scrapped 2 earlier versions before he got to his third because of everything that happened between end of 2015 down to 2018.
His biggest enemy has always been the obstacles hes had to face through. Alongside with it Hes been expanding his business. While Dime Trap showed growth in many aspects it still was a very unfinished product. But with LIBRA he actually had the TIME do really go through the album, refine it and come up with something and it shows.
It never really excuses anything but ever since he got screwed over on No Mercy & Trouble Man where new people got in to Atlantic Record, yeah he hasnt really had the chance to truly refine and perfect the albums the way he wanted to.
